Specs:
Pattern: Flame Cardigan from Vogue Spring/Summer 2005
Yarn: Old stashed merino/angora I think?
Gauge: 32st over pattern repeat
Needle size: 6US
And from the back:
I chose to not add that funky crochet bit between the ribbing and the upper pattern, and I lengthened the ribbing, ’cause I’m just not a cropped kinda gal. And you remember when I messed up that sleeve pattern? You can’t tell. If you see me at the Sheep and Wolf Estival, you might pick it out, but not from a trotting horse.
